In the late summer of 2007, 54-year-old Renee Lynette Kyles, a Black female standing 5 feet 3 inches and weighing 115 pounds, disappeared from Kalamazoo, Michigan. She was a mother and grandmother who had moved to the area from Chicago in 1999 to be closer to her family. Those who knew her described her as someone who talked fast and often wore a short, black wig.
